Blockchain Technology

Blockchain Innovation has been a total game-changer for us. It’s as if a vast, impenetrable digital ledger that all can view, and it cannot be altered without the knowledge of everyone.

This is excellent for monitoring our goods and ensuring that everyone is aligned with our supply chain. Leading companies such as Walmart and IBM are already employing this and obtaining remarkable outcomes.

Internet of Things (IoT)

And then there’s the concept, or IoT, which is another important issue. It’s focuses on devices, vehicles, structures, and more that are linked and are able to exchange data.

In supply chain management, IoT devices can help us monitor our products closely, keep an eye on our inventory, and even predict when something needs fixing. It’s focuses on making better choices and being more efficient.

Big Data Analytics

Large-scale data analysis is like having a tool for detailed examination for vast amounts of information. It helps us find hidden trends and indicators about what customer preferences and what the market trends. In supply chain management, big data helps us figure out the optimal paths, estimate our product requirements, and reduce expenses. DHL logistics company and UPS logistics company are already doing this to remain competitive.

AI and Machine Learning

AI and machine learning are like the intelligent assistants of logistics. AI can sift through large amounts of data to provide predictions and recommendations, and machine learning helps it get better through learning from new stuff.

With this tech, with the ability to adjust our routes, guess when our equipment requires maintenance, and even let the machines do some of the work. Those companies such as Amazon and DHL are pioneering this area.
